My approach to providing therapy is authenticity, curiosity, emotional safety and compassion.

I specialize in working with people who suffer from depression or anxiety, but whose public facing selves are high functioning. The weight of this bind can diminish our capacity to feel joy. Often times my clients initially report feeling disconnected. In our work together, we will find the beliefs and patterns that keep you stuck or in distress. Together, we will explore these places and discover ways to heal and grow beyond them. I think of therapy like a gym routine for your mind.  By building up your reserves, we strengthen your resilience for life’s more pronounced ups and downs.

I am in a constant state of discovery about my own profession. I live and breathe this work. I spend much of my personal time reading, researching and attending continuing education in several advanced attachment based modalities. I am an integrative therapist in that I use what will work best for each individual client. I am Certified in Accelerated Experiential Dynamic Psychotherapy (AEDP). This is a mouthful but what it boils down to is this: We quickly cut through the layers of content to address the underlying emotions. My passion is to get to the core of what ails you so that you can finally breathe free in your life again.
